This stands for Heidi Device Interface . Heidi is Autodesk’s legacy graphics and rendering engine architecture used to communicate between AutoCAD and your hardware.

Typically, AutoCAD relies on specialized hardware drivers (like DirectX 11 or 12) to leverage your computer’s Graphics Processing Unit (GPU) for rendering complex 2D and 3D geometry. The gdi16.hdi driver acts as a "fallback" or "safe mode" for graphics. It uses the to handle rendering tasks via the CPU instead of the GPU. Why You See gdi16.hdi
